  • Welcome! We are currently getting licensed and also moving. I am not sure how it is where you live, but where we live we can go ahead and get licensed and then when we move they will just make one visit to update our home study. The licensing process has taken us about 4 months, so we are glad we went ahead and started. Just a thought. Best of luck to you!

  • We are currently pursuing foster parent licensing. We aren't moving, but the "home" part of the home study is only a small piece. You can definitely start, if that's what you want to do. In our area, the classes are only offered once a year, so you can at least inquire and find out exactly what is involved in your area.
